The final day of #PHPN2025 is off to a great start with the breakout session, “Exploring the Role of Race and Ethnicity in Methamphetamine Use Patterns in PAH.”
Speaker Raquel Lyn, MD, reviewed the connection between substance abuse and #PAH, and the rise of use in underrepresented communities.

In “Foundations of a Successful Care Team: Part II,” symposium attendees learned how providers from different accredited #PHCareCenters manage their multidisciplinary care team.
Speakers covered their experiences caring for both #pediatric and adult #pulmonaryhypertension patients.

Day two of the 2025 PHPN Symposium is underway with a plenary session focused on practicing self-compassion and managing burnout.
Speaker Jeffrey J. Lauzon, MA, PhD, shared strategies for providers to manage their own well-being while providing optimal care for PH patients.

In the #PHPN2025 opening session, Eric Borstein and Kate Salonga shared their experiences living with PH in the United States and Canada.
Hosted in collaboration with PHA Canada, speakers highlighted the importance of shared decision making for successful #PH care.
